Transaction 631abafcae10317db1b286e49b0f90df9f56c8443a2a1a2bb2ea956023faf0be
1 Input
1 Output
-
631abafcae10317db1b286e49b0f90df9f56c8443a2a1a2bb2ea956023faf0be:0
- value
- 161889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 464d22aa21f856682348e7602a6d492dda3be00a OP_EQUAL
- address
- 386jdS8K6ZheJs3X4gpmsojSdSP8xLeMDn